Content Strategy Framework

Jay Hae Min Lee approaches content as a product, applying structured frameworks to each initiative. Strategy starts with audience insights, competitor mapping, and platform specific constraints.

By combining weekly performance reviews with scenario planning, he aligns creative concepts with measurable outcomes. This section highlights how his methods balance experimentation with sustainable production.

Audience Research

Deep interviews, surveys, and on platform analytics inform who he is reaching and why they engage.

Experimentation Cadence

Rapid cycles of testing formats, hooks, and calls to action reduce risk and surface winning patterns quickly.

Platform Performance Insights

Different platforms reward distinct behaviors, and Jay Hae Min Lee tailors style, length, and posting rhythm accordingly. Short form video favors fast context, while long form content supports depth and authority building.

His cross platform playbook coordinates messaging so that audiences meet consistent value whether they discover him on TikTok, YouTube, or professional networks. Data driven adjustments keep each channel optimized without diluting the core narrative.

Platform Primary Format Posting Frequency Success Metric
YouTube Explainer and deep dive videos 2 3 weekly Watch time, click through rate
TikTok Quick tips and storytelling clips Daily Completion rate, shares
LinkedIn Professional insights and case studies 3 4 weekly Engagement, connection requests
X Timely commentary and links Daily Retweets, replies
